Review for Volunteers for Veterans Foundation, Fontana, CA, USA

Rating: 4 stars  

The Department of Veteran Affairs has been a direct recipient of this awesome organization and people. For over 25 years. This group has worked tirelessly every year to raise funds to go directly to Veterans in need. They have provided funds for food, rent, utilities, car insurance, clothing, etc. I could go on and on about how much they have done not only for our hospitalized Veterans with providing support to many events and programs, including, Women Veterans, Returning Combat Veterans, Social Work Emergency Fund, Eyeglasses, Hygiene Kits, Vet Centers, Recreational Therapy and the Community Living Center.
I am so grateful to the Volks and committee for all their love and support for America's Hero's.

Review for Volunteers for Veterans Foundation, Fontana, CA, USA

Rating: 5 stars  

Volunteers for Veterans Foundation has been the answer to many prayers by the Loma Linda VA Healthcare System staff and veterans. i have had the pleasure of working with them for the past seventeen years. These committee members are the most dedicated, supportive and caring people I have ever met. They have donated more then one million dollars to our Medical Center, providing support for many programs, events and equiment needs that our hospital budget cannot support. These people work all year long to prepare for the wonderful event, Veterans Car Show.The distriution of these funds have gone to support, Homeless Veterans, OIF-OEF, Returning Combat Veterans, Women Veterans Program and awareness,Eyeglasses for those that do not meet the criteria or do not have funds of their own, POW Programs, Social Work Services, which provides food, bus tickets, gas cards, etc. to needy vets, they have in the past also donated a Ambulance Van to transport critical care patients, which has save the Medical Center over 1 million a year. To sum it up the Volunteers for Veterans Foundation and it's Committee members are the epitome of Volunteerism for our American Heroes.
